A 54-year-old woman was given a police caution after being found to be growing a small amount of cannabis plants.
The electricity meter had been bypassed and has now been made safe, the electricity company will be pursuing the money owed.

Hide AdIn a separate incident a 23-year-old man was arrested in Balby on suspicion of possession with intent to supply drugs and possession of an offensive weapon.
He was stop searched by officers who saw him acting suspiciously in a park and found to be in possession of a knuckle duster and what is suspected to be controlled drugs.
Also yesteday, officers in the town centre arrested a 47-year-old man on suspicion of three assaults and also breaching a Public Space Protection Order.
A spokesman said: “He remains in custody and will be interviewed when he is sober.”
